Output 016836222d672a871139754b80a5e1ba800b079708f95211861b979b61d77981:53

value
31059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bd30cd47effb6bb40f4ddb3c34a7a29318eeae OP_EQUAL
address
36VshiPuM1CYfUQHPUAXXoiSYeuAJN6SQo
transaction
016836222d672a871139754b80a5e1ba800b079708f95211861b979b61d77981
spent
true